Sylvie Bellerose holds a bachelor's degree in biological sciences from Université de Montréal. Prior to joining IRDA she supervised a beneficial insect production facility and then worked at Agriculture and Agri-Food Canada as an acarology-entomology technician. In June 2019, Sylvie was appointed as a research assistant at IRDA. Over the years she has been involved in various fruit entomology projects aimed at reducing the impact of pesticide use and developing alternative pest management strategies. She is currently working on various market gardening projects with an emphasis on organic production.
Sylvie Bellerose has worked at IRDA for over 20 years and has held a variety of jobs in both research and management.
